New uniforms at London hotel’s nightclub react to music

W London – Leicester Square has partnered with British fashion star Claire Barrow and Glofaster to design new uniforms for the hotel’s nightclub, Wyld.

The new uniform collection features integrated LED technology that pulsates to the beats of the club’s resident DJ. Reactive strip lighting, made by Glofaster, is set within a W screen-printed design that was influenced by the club’s glowing red neon lights. Both male and female uniforms also boast Barrow’s signature embroidered motifs, with designs that take inspiration from Wyld’s oversized disco ball and London’s vibrant night scene.

“My designs for Wyld’s new uniforms were influenced by the décor of the nightclub,” Barrow said. “I wanted the wearer to feel confident and enjoy working in the garments, so we created timeless tailored pieces for men and women. Glofaster and I wanted the uniforms to feature smart capabilities that would accentuate the design, making the staff stand out from the crowd and ultimately support them in their role.”
